出 处:《细胞与分子免疫学杂志》2002年第6期634-636,共3页Chinese Journal of Cellular and Molecular Immunology
摘 要:目的 探讨一氧化氮 (NO)与白细胞精子症不育的关系。方法 参照WHO标准方法 ,进行精液常规分析。采用过氧化物酶染色法检测精液中白细胞密度。用改良的低渗肿胀法检测精子细胞膜的完整性。采用镀铜镉还原荧光法 ,检测精液中NO代谢产物硝酸盐 (NO 3 )。结果 白细胞精子症不育组白细胞的密度为 (1.4 8± 0 .90 )× 10 9/L ,NO水平为 (10 3.5± 2 .0 ) μmol/L ,显著高于正常生育组的(0 .73± 0 .2 8)× 10 9/L和 (41.6± 1.8) μmol/L (P分别为<0 .0 5和 <0 .0 0 1)。精子的活动率、精子速度试验 (SVT)及精子头、尾部膜完整率 ,均明显低于生育组 (P <0 .0 1) ,而精子的死亡率则显著高于生育组 (P <0 .0 1)。结论 NO水平与白细胞密度呈正相关 ;与精子的活动率、SVT及精子头、尾膜的完整率呈负相关。表明当精液中的白细胞增高时 。Aim To explore the relationship between nitric oxide and leucocyte sperm disease infertility. Methods Conventional sperm analysis was carried out according to WHO standard method. Leucocytic density in semen was detected by peroxidase staining. Integrity of spermatid membrane was examined by improved hyponotic swelling test. A coppered reduced cadmium fluometric assay was used to detect nitrate (NO 3), a metablic product of nitric oxide in semen. Results Semen leucocytic density and nitric oxide level in leucocyte sperm disease infertility group\[(1.48±0.90)×10 9/L and (103.5±2.0) μmol/L, respectively\] were significantly higher than those in normal fertility group \[(0.73±0.28)×10 9/L and (41.6±1.8) μmol/L, respectively\]. ( P <0.05 and P <0.001, respectively). Motile rate of sperm , sperm'velocity test(SVT) and intact rate of sperm head and tail membranes in leucocyte sperm disease group were markedly lower than those in fertility group ( P <0.01), while mortality of sperm was quite the contrary ( P <0.01). Conclusion Nitric oxide level is positively correlated with leucocytic density , wherease negatively correlated with motile rate of sperm, SVT and intact rate of sperm head and tail membranes. It shows that excessive leucocytes in semen may produce excessive nitric oxide which poisons and damages sperm, thus reduceing fertility rate.
